1. What is maca root?
Maca root, also known as Peruvian ginseng, is a root vegetable that has been cultivated in the Andean region of Peru for thousands of years. It is a member of the cruciferous family, which includes broccoli, cauliflower, and kale. Maca root is rich in essential vitamins, minerals, and nutrients, making it a potent superfood.

2. How does maca root affect sperm health?
Maca root has been traditionally used as a fertility booster in South America. Studies have shown that maca root can improve sperm count, motility, and overall sperm quality. It contains high levels of antioxidants, which can protect sperm cells from oxidative stress and damage. Maca root also contains essential amino acids that play a crucial role in sperm production.

7. Are there any precautions to take when consuming maca root?
Maca root is generally safe for consumption, but there are a few precautions to keep in mind. If you have a thyroid condition, it is recommended to consult with a healthcare professional before consuming maca root as it may interfere with thyroid function. Additionally, pregnant or breastfeeding women should also consult with a doctor before taking maca root.
